Newlyweds: Health Insurance Planning
It can get complex when deciding to add and subtract family members. Employer plans are usually much cheaper for the employee than dependents.
Take into account:
- Health
- Frequency of doctors visits
- Expensive drugs
- If you are planning any children
- Dependent children from another marriage
- Your budget
Some members with recurent health issues, pending surgery or on expensive prescription drugs, may be stuck in their current health plan.
Some suggestions:
- Before "ordering a baby," enroll in a group plan or consider a dreaded HMO
- Group plans usually don't consider health, so take advantage of them for "sickies"
- Make sure your maximum exposure is low (out of pocket)
- Consider a PPO over an HMO
- If healthy, look at a plan with a higher co payment
- Avoid single disease insurance policies, they are not health insurance!
